Ingredients You’ll Need
Let’s talk about the star players in this recipe! They are simple and wholesome ingredients that come together beautifully to create something truly special. Here’s what you’ll need:
For the Chicken
- 2 small chicken breasts
- 2 tablespoons of poultry seasoning (or salt, pepper, garlic powder)
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
For the Garlic Bread
- 1 Italian style loaf
- 1 1/2 sticks of unsalted butter
- 2 tablespoons minced garlic (or garlic paste)
- 2 tablespoons of chopped parsley
- 1 teaspoon of crushed red pepper flakes
For the Sauce
- 1/4 cup of shredded parmesan cheese
- 1/2 cup of sh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1/2 cup heavy cream

How to Make The Viral Chicken Alfredo Garlic Bread I’m Obsessed With
Step 1: Prepare the Chicken
Cut the chicken breasts into ½ inch pieces and transfer them to a bowl. Drizzle with olive oil and season with poultry seasoning (or your preferred mix). Cooking the chicken until golden not only enhances its flavor but also adds a lovely texture that complements the creamy sauce later on.
Step 2: Toast the Garlic Bread
Slice your Italian loaf lengthwise in half. In a small bowl, combine melted butter, minced garlic, chopped parsley, and crushed red pepper flakes. This mixture infuses amazing flavor into your bread! Spread it evenly on both halves and toast in a preheated oven until they reach your desired crunchiness.
Step 3: Make the Alfredo Sauce
Using the same pan from the chicken (no need to wash it!), melt half a stick of butter over medium-low heat. Stir in minced garlic until fragrant—this step really elevates your sauce by bringing out that garlicky goodness! Then gently simmer cream and parmesan cheese until thickened slightly. This creates that luscious sauce we all crave!
Step 4: Assemble Your Dish
Spread half of your prepared sauce over each toasted bread half. Layer on your cooked chicken and top with mozzarella cheese and remaining sauce. This ensures every bite is packed with creamy goodness!
Step 5: Final Bake
Return your loaded garlic bread to the oven for another quick bake until all that cheesy goodness melts beautifully. The aroma will have everyone rushing to the table!
Step 6: Serve Warm
Slice into 2-3 inch pieces and serve while warm. Enjoy every cheesy bite—you deserve it!

Make Ahead and Storage
This Chicken Alfredo Garlic Bread is not just delicious; it’s also perfect for meal prep! You can easily make it ahead of time, store leftovers, or even freeze it for later. Here’s how to keep your tasty creation fresh and ready to enjoy.
Storing Leftovers
- Allow the chicken Alfredo garlic bread to cool completely before storing.
- Wrap the leftover bread t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il.
-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
Freezing
- To freeze, slice the bread into individual portions before wrapping.
- Wrap each piece securely in plastic wrap followed by aluminum foil to prevent freezer burn.
- Store in the freezer for up to 2 months.
Reheating
- For best results, reheat in the oven at 350°F for about 10-15 minutes until warmed through and the cheese is melty.
- If using a microwave, heat on medium power for 1-2 minutes, but be aware this might make the bread a bit soft.

-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 25 minutes
- Total Time: 35 minutes
- Yield: Serves 4
- Category: Dinner
- Method: Baking
- Cuisine: Italian
Ingredients
- 2 small chicken breasts
- 1 Italian style loaf
- 1/2 cup heavy cream
- 1/4 cup shredded parmesan cheese
- 1/2 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 2 tablespoons of poultry seasoning (or salt, pepper, garlic powder)
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 1/2 sticks of unsalted butter
- 2 tablespoons minced garlic (or garlic paste)
- 2 tablespoons of chopped parsley
- 1 teaspoon of crushed red pepper flakes
Instructions
- Prepare the chicken by cutting it into bite-sized pieces. Season with olive oil and poultry seasoning before cooking until golden.
- Toast the Italian loaf halves topped with a mixture of melted butter, minced garlic, chopped parsley, and crushed red pepper flakes.
- In the same pan used for chicken, make the Alfredo sauce by combining butter, garlic, cream, and parmesan until thickened.
- Assemble by spreading sauce on toasted bread, layering with chicken and mozzarella cheese.
- Bake until cheese is melted and bubbly.
- Serve warm in slices.
